Abstract
Methods and systems for a deep-learning platform for sorting cell populations. An example method includes executing a software-platform associated with analyzing received flow cytometry data obtained via an acquisition device in communication with the computing system, and the software-platform sorting cell populations indicated in the flow cytometry data. User input is received indicating selection of a deep-learning module, the deep-learning module being obtained via a network to supplement the software-platform. The flow cytometry data is analyzed and a machine learning model is selected which was trained based on similar phenotype information as indicated in the flow cytometry data. The machine learning model is applied based on the flow cytometry data, the information being normalized based on the UMI counts associated with the flow cytometry data. A graphical representation of cell populations indicated in the flow cytometry data is presented, the graphical representation sorting the cell populations according to phenotype information.
